The WD My Passport 2TB offers solid storage capacity, strong hardware encryption, and a lightweight, bus-powered design, making it a reliable portable backup for Windows users.

The Toshiba Canvio Basics 1TB provides a straightforward, bus-powered HDD solution with solid reliability, drop protection, and broad OS compatibility, but it lacks encryption, USB-C, and bundled software. It's ideal for users who need affordable portable storage without the need for high-speed performance.

Professional reviewers note that the Canvio Basics delivers solid, no-frills performance with a focus on reliability and ease of use, praising its rugged enclosure and lack of bloatware while pointing out the limited speed and missing modern connectivity features.
Everyday users consistently praise the drive's plug-and-play nature, compact size, and durability, while complaining about the need to reformat for macOS, lack of encryption, and occasional read-only issues on Windows.

Professional reviewers praise its reliability, security features, and value, while noting the misleading USB-C marketing due to the Micro-USB port.
Users rate it highly for dependable performance and ease of use on Windows, but complain about the USB type mismatch and the need to reformat for Mac.
